New Restaurant Concept


Follow all Panache blogs: #books; #entertaiment; #grilling; #nationalentertainment; #romance; #videogames

Take a number. Oriole, owned and operated by Chefs Noah and Cara Sandoval and Genie Kwon, is slated to open in the West Loop in winter. The intimate (28-seat) eatery, will feature 15-18 course tasting menu designed around wine and drink pairings. Seafood-inspired items, among Noah Sandoval's favorites, will be among highlights. The thought behind the concept is to create an interactive atmosphere that inspires conversation, in an interactive setting. Stay posted for official opening date and more information.

Revolution/Shedd's Limited Edition Brew

Follow all Panache blogs: #books; #entertaiment; #grilling; #nationalentertainment; #romance; #videogames

Revolution Brewing's Penguin Hops at the Shedd release party is 5-10 p.m. Oct. 28. The craft beer event features a free sample of the fall brew. In addition $1 from every pint of Penguin Hops purchased will be donated to the Shedd in support of its learning programs and other missions. Penguin Hops, a limited edition harvest ale is created by Revolution from hops vines cultivated by the Shedd. Click here for more information.
